Virtual Intensive Outpatient Programs (IOP) offer a critical lifeline for individuals grappling with mental health and substance use challenges, providing structured care from the comfort of their homes. This modern approach allows residents to prioritize their mental well-being without sacrificing their daily commitments.
For those living in Akron, the benefits of Virtual IOP are substantial. With the ability to attend sessions from home, individuals can maintain their work, school, and family responsibilities while receiving the help they need. Programs typically involve 9-20 hours of therapy per week, with evidence-based treatments such as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) and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) available. The flexibility of scheduling makes these programs particularly appealing for Akron residents seeking effective care.
Getting started with a Virtual IOP is straightforward. Local programs offer a mix of individual, group, and family therapy sessions, all conducted via HIPAA-compliant video conferencing. Most major insurance plans, including Medicare and Medicaid, are accepted, making these vital resources accessible to a wide range of individuals.
